Ekaterina Andreeva called Ovsyannikova a “traitor”: “I could pour green paint”

The host of the Vremya program, Ekaterina Andreeva, commented on the incident with the poster, with which Marina Ovsyannikova, the editor of Channel One, burst into the air of her program on March 14, reports News.ru.

In response to Ovsyannikova’s assertion that Channel One was lying, Andreeva stated that she would never agree to this. “We always carefully check all the facts,” the presenter explained, pointing to the absence of lawsuits.

According to Andreeva, Ovsyannikova got into the news studio without any problems, because everyone knew her well and did not expect this. The presenter called the editor “a thief on trust.”

“She could hit me on the head, pour green paint on me,” Andreeva said, calling Ovsyannikova a “traitor.”

According to the TV presenter, it would be more honest for Ovsyannikova to quit, in a situation where her views differ from the position of the channel. Andreeva cited as an example a similar act of two other employees, to whom in this case she treated with understanding.

Andreeva added that Ovsyannikova has a young man living abroad, to whom, according to the TV presenter, she will go now.
